A 3-month-old boy died from a head injury, prompting a murder investigation in Cambridgeshire, UK.
A three-month-old boy, Atijus Elertaite, died on January 8 after suffering a head injury, prompting Cambridgeshire Police to launch a murder investigation.
Officers responded to a property in St John's Chase, March, on January 3 after a medical emergency call, and the infant was hospitalized in critical condition.
A preliminary post-mortem indicated a head injury as the cause of death, with further tests pending.
A 25-year-old woman and a 22-year-old man from March were initially arrested on suspicion of grievous bodily harm and later re-arrested on suspicion of murder; both remain in custody.
Police are urging anyone with information to come forward while cautioning against speculation, especially online.
